The Mexico U-20 National Team represents the future of Mexican soccer, embodying the hopes and dreams of a nation passionate about the beautiful game. This team serves as a crucial stepping stone for young talents aiming to break into the senior national team and make their mark on the international stage. Understanding the significance of the U-20 squad requires a look at its role in developing players, its competitive performances, and the impact it has on the broader landscape of Mexican football. For young players, being selected for the Mexico U-20 team is a monumental achievement, a validation of their hard work and potential. It's an opportunity to train in a professional environment, receive top-notch coaching, and compete against some of the best young players from around the world. This exposure is invaluable for their development, helping them to hone their skills, improve their tactical understanding, and build the mental fortitude needed to succeed at the highest levels. The U-20 team also provides a platform for these players to showcase their talents to scouts from both domestic and international clubs, potentially opening doors to professional careers.

One of the primary goals of the Mexico U-20 program is player development. The coaching staff focuses not only on winning matches but also on nurturing the individual skills and tactical awareness of each player. Training sessions are designed to be challenging and comprehensive, covering everything from technical drills to strategic game planning. Players are encouraged to think critically, make quick decisions under pressure, and work effectively as a team. This holistic approach to development ensures that these young talents are well-prepared for the demands of professional soccer. Moreover, the U-20 team plays a vital role in identifying and grooming future leaders. Players who demonstrate exceptional leadership qualities, both on and off the field, are given opportunities to take on greater responsibility within the team. This helps to cultivate the next generation of captains and role models for Mexican soccer. Competitive Performance and Achievements

The Mexico U-20 National Team consistently competes in major international tournaments, including the FIFA U-20 World Cup and the CONCACAF U-20 Championship. These competitions provide invaluable experience for the players, exposing them to different playing styles, cultures, and levels of competition. The team's performance in these tournaments is closely followed by fans and media alike, as it offers a glimpse into the future of Mexican soccer. Over the years, the Mexico U-20 team has achieved notable success in the CONCACAF U-20 Championship, often securing qualification for the FIFA U-20 World Cup. These achievements are a testament to the quality of the players and the coaching staff, as well as the effectiveness of the youth development programs in Mexico. At the FIFA U-20 World Cup, the team has faced some of the toughest opponents from around the globe, providing a challenging but rewarding experience for the players. While winning the tournament is always the ultimate goal, the primary focus is on providing a platform for these young talents to develop and showcase their abilities.

Participating in these tournaments not only helps the players grow but also elevates the profile of Mexican soccer on the international stage. A strong showing by the U-20 team can inspire young players across the country and generate excitement among fans. It also demonstrates the progress that Mexico is making in developing its youth talent and competing with the best soccer nations in the world. Furthermore, the exposure gained from these tournaments can lead to opportunities for players to join top clubs in Europe and South America, further enhancing their development and contributing to the overall growth of Mexican soccer. The competitive spirit and determination displayed by the Mexico U-20 team in these tournaments reflect the passion and pride that Mexicans have for their national team. They represent the hopes and aspirations of a nation eager to see its young players succeed on the world stage. Impact on Mexican Soccer

The Mexico U-20 National Team plays a significant role in the overall structure of Mexican soccer, serving as a bridge between the youth academies and the senior national team. Many players who have come through the U-20 ranks have gone on to become stars for the senior team, representing Mexico in major international competitions such as the FIFA World Cup and the CONCACAF Gold Cup. This demonstrates the effectiveness of the U-20 program in identifying and developing talent that can contribute at the highest level. The success of the U-20 team also has a positive impact on the development of youth soccer in Mexico. It inspires young players to dream big and work hard, knowing that there is a pathway to the national team. It also encourages investment in youth academies and coaching programs, as clubs and federations recognize the importance of developing young talent. Furthermore, the U-20 team helps to create a sense of national pride and unity. When the team competes in international tournaments, it brings together fans from all over the country to support their young players. This shared experience can strengthen the bonds between Mexicans and create a sense of collective identity.

The impact of the Mexico U-20 team extends beyond the field, as it also helps to promote positive values such as teamwork, discipline, and sportsmanship. Players are taught to respect their opponents, follow the rules, and conduct themselves with integrity. These values are essential not only for success in soccer but also for success in life. The U-20 team also serves as a platform for promoting social responsibility. Players are encouraged to use their platform to raise awareness about important social issues and to give back to their communities. This helps to create a generation of socially conscious athletes who are committed to making a positive impact on the world.
